Englebert has slender strokes, open counters, and a loose, handwritten-like construction that still reads as a clean sans serif. The letters lean slightly with irregular touches, giving text a human, informal tone rather than a polished corporate feel. It tends to shine in short, punchy lines—think display titles, labels, or UI tags—where its gentle awkwardness feels intentional and charming. For dense editorial layouts or strict, formal branding systems it can look too casual, so you may want a more neutral grotesk there. If you like relaxed geometric sans styles but want something more characterful, this strikes a nice middle ground.
